Characteristics of Ore-Controlling Structures in the Yangla Copper Deposit and Luchun Cu-Pb-Zn Deposit, Western Yunnan

The Yangla copper deposit and Luchun Cu-Pb-Zn deposit are located in the middle section of Jinshajiang metallogenic belt. The Yangla copper deposit, which is a representive copper deposit in the Jinshajiang-Laneangjiang-Nujiang region, hosts an estimated Cu reserve of about 1.2 × 106 tons. The orebodies are hosted in the melange composed of diverse rocks. The ores were deposited in pre-existing thrust faults in Indosinian period and steeply dipping normal fault in Himalayan period. The directions of the maximum principal stress were E-W and NE-SW in the Yangla deposit. E-W direction was related to the westwards subduction of the Jinshajiang Oceanic plate in Indosinian, NE-SW related to the collision between India plate and Asia plate in Himalayan. The Luchun Cu-Pb-Zn deposit is bordered by the Indosinian thrust fault.
